Ticket #2093 — Badge System Migration, Orrin Building

Old Keystone readers go offline Friday 17:00. New Vantrell readers active Monday 08:00. Over the weekend, all doors default to manual override. Team assistants: collect old badges from your teams by Thursday and drop them at the facilities desk. New badges will be issued Monday morning, floor by floor. Anyone needing weekend access must use the side entrance on Pellow Street with the interim code below.

turnstile pass: bdg-QZV-3

Changed defaults for the Brightfern clinic reminder job (v2.9). Heads up, future maintainers: the job now sends reminders 48 hours out instead of 24, after the Oakhollow pilot showed fewer no-shows. Quiet hours are respected by default, and SMS retries dropped from five to two because carriers were flagging us. If you need the old behavior, override it per-tenant. The job ships with the following default configuration values.

config for yajef-tajof:
[belius]
host = belius.crelvolabs.internal
user = belius_svc
database = belius_prod

Each build emits a signed attestation covering source revision, toolchain digest, and dependency lockfile hash, verified at deploy time by the Gatewarden admission controller. Reviewers should confirm the attestation chain terminates at the offline root key held by the platform team. The attestation for the currently deployed release references the build token shown below.

trace token, fafog-kageg: htk4_98e6

**Step 2: Enable incremental rebuilds**

Switch the Slatepress builder from full rebuilds to incremental. Only changed pages and their dependents regenerate; everything else is served from the build cache. Verify the cache volume is mounted before enabling, or the first build will be a full one. Set the following values.

service settings:
PRAWYN_PIN=9848
PRAWYN_METRICS_HOST=metrics.prawyn.lumicworks.corp
PRAWYN_LOG_LEVEL=warn
PRAWYN_TENANT=pelius

Handing off the Quillbase planner regression to you before I'm out. Since the 4.2 merge, join reordering picks a nested loop over hash join when stats are stale, inflating p99 latency on the reporting shard. I've bisected it to the cardinality estimator change; the failing plans are reproducible with the fixture suite. My annotated plan diffs and notes are collected on this page.

runbook for badug-kadup: https://confluence.zemvarlabs.internal/projects/browse/display/projects/bd1b